What Is a Current Transformer Cabinet
A current transformer cabinet is an enclosure that safely houses current transformers (CTs) along with associated wiring, busbars, and protective devices. These cabinets serve multiple purposes:
Protection: Shield CTs from dust, moisture, corrosion, and mechanical impact.
Organization: Ensure structured arrangement of CTs, wiring, and auxiliary devices for easy maintenance.
Safety: Prevent accidental contact with high-voltage components and reduce the risk of electrical hazards.
Monitoring & Control: Provide a stable platform for current measurement devices used in metering, protection relays, and energy management systems.

6. Installation and Maintenance Considerations
Proper installation and maintenance are key to maximizing CT cabinet performance:
Location: Place cabinets in dry, ventilated, and secure areas to prevent environmental damage.
Connection: Ensure wiring, busbars, and CT terminals are correctly rated and insulated.
Periodic Inspection: Check for loose connections, corrosion, or wear on insulation.
Calibration: Verify CT accuracy and protective device settings to maintain measurement integrity.
